What is GPT-4?
GPT-4, short for "Generative Pre-trained Transformer 4," is the latest iteration of OpenAI's GPT series, following in the footsteps of GPT-3.5. Like its predecessors, GPT-4 is a language model designed to understand and generate human-like text. However, what sets GPT-4 apart is its unprecedented scale, improved capabilities, and its potential to revolutionize various industries.

Few-shot and Customization
Building on the success of few-shot learning in GPT-3, GPT-4 takes it to the next level. Few-shot learning allows users to provide minimal examples or instructions to the model to perform specific tasks. GPT-4's improved few-shot capabilities make it even easier for developers and users to customize the model for specific applications, reducing the need for extensive fine-tuning.
